Forecasting Technique Earns $25K
Matthew Haugland is $25,000 richer today after winning The Collegiate Inventors Competition for his microscale weather forecasting technique to predict overnight temperatures. Besides presumably eventually bringing more accurate temperature forecasts to the general public, the article on their site says that the "Uncoupled surface layer model" should help farmers protect crops and will have implications on the forecasting of overnight fog, which causes the most transportation deaths each year.
